Sri Sai Ram Ayurveda Medical College & Research Centre, Chennai is a private Ayurveda college started in 2001 under the Sapthagiri Educational Trust. The college is affiliated with The Tamil Nadu Dr. M.G.R. Medical University, Chennai, and recognized by the National Commission for Indian System of Medicine (NCISM) and the Ministry of AYUSH, Government of India. It boasts one of the first NABH-accredited Ayurveda hospitals in Tamil Nadu with modern facilities, Panchakarma amenities, herbal gardens, research labs, and clinical training.
Admission into the BAMS course is through NEET UG 2026 and Tamil Nadu AYUSH Counselling. The institute has a sanctioned intake of 50 BAMS seats annually.

Sri Sai Ram Ayurveda Medical College BAMS Admission 2026

The admission to BAMS course will be done through NEET UG 2026 examination followed by Tamil Nadu AYUSH Counselling. Candidates must qualify NEET UG and participate in the centralized counselling process. The BAMS course consists of 5.5 years, including one-year compulsory rotatory internship.

Eligibility – BAMS

  • Must have passed Class 12 with Physics, Chemistry, Biology, and English.
  • General category candidates require a minimum of 50% marks in PCB.
  • Reserved category candidates require a minimum of 40% marks in PCB.
  • Completion of 17 years of age before or on 31 December 2026.
  • Must qualify NEET UG 2026.

How to Apply – BAMS

  • Take NEET UG 2026.
  • Score a good mark in NEET UG.
  • Sign up for Tamil Nadu AYUSH Counselling.
  • Go through document verification.
  • Choose and lock your college preferences.
  • Join counselling rounds.
  • Print allotment letter.
  • College reporting for admission confirmation.

Documents Required for Admission 2026

To get into the college, you need documents. These are

  • NEET UG Marks Card
  • NEET UG Admit Card
  • Your Class 10 and 12 Marksheets and Certificates
  • Transfer Certificate
  • Migration Certificate if you need it
  • Nativity or Domicile Certificate if you need it
  • Community or Category Certificate if you need it
  • Aadhar Card or any other photo ID given by the government
  • Recent Passport Size Photographs
  • NRI Sponsorship Documents if you are applying under the NRI Quota
